Understanding Scripting Logic and Variables
The scripting logic, while visually oriented, still requires a basic understanding of fundamental programming concepts such as variables, conditional statements, and loops. Variables are used to store data, such as player scores, object positions, or timer values. Conditional statements allow the platform to respond differently to different events, such as a player pressing a button or colliding with an object. Loops enable repetitive actions to be performed automatically, such as creating a continuous animation or spawning new objects. Mastering these concepts is crucial for creating truly dynamic and engaging experiences. The platform provides a clear and concise documentation of its scripting language, making it easier for users to learn and understand the underlying mechanics.

Optimizing Performance and Resource Management
Creating complex experiences can quickly strain system resources. Therefore, optimizing performance is crucial for providing a smooth and enjoyable user experience. Several factors can impact performance, including the number of objects in the scene, the complexity of the textures, and the efficiency of the scripting code. Users should strive to minimize the number of unnecessary objects and reduce the resolution of textures where possible. Efficient scripting code is also essential. Avoid using loops that iterate over large numbers of objects and optimize conditional statements to minimize the number of calculations performed. The platform provides a performance profiling tool that allows users to identify bottlenecks and optimize their creations. Understanding these concepts will allow users to create immersive experiences without compromising playability.
Utilizing Level of Detail and Culling Techniques
Level of Detail (LOD) is a technique that involves reducing the detail of objects as they move further away from the camera. This reduces the number of polygons that need to be rendered, significantly improving performance. Culling techniques involve removing objects from the scene that are not visible to the camera. This further reduces the rendering workload. The platform supports both LOD and culling techniques, allowing users to optimize their creations without sacrificing visual quality. Employing these strategies requires careful planning and experimentation, but the rewards in terms of performance gains can be substantial.
